Vue Echarts 是一種用于可視化的 JavaScript 庫,而股票應用則是 Echarts 最為常見的使用場景之一。Vue Echarts 股票應用可以為投資者提供股票數據的實時展示、分析、比較和預測,以協助他們做出更明智的投資決策。
在使用 Vue Echarts 股票應用時,一般會使用以下的數據流程:
import echarts from 'echarts'
import VueEcharts from 'vue-echarts'
export default {
components: { VueEcharts },
data () {
return {
chartData: []
}
},
mounted: async function() {
const data = await fetch('http://api.stock.com/latestData')
this.chartData = data
},
props: ['symbol'],
computed: {
chartOptions () {
const option = {
// 編寫 Echarts 相關配置
}
return option
}
}
}
根據以上代碼,我們將 echarts 和 vue-echarts 庫通過 import 語句引入,隨后在 data 中聲明 chartData 變量來接收獲取到的數據,mounted 方法中使用 fetch 從指定地址獲得最新股票數據并傳遞給 chartData。
而在 props 中聲明 symbol 來接收單個股票的標識符,從而在計算屬性 chartOptions 中生成 Echarts 配置并返回。
這樣,我們就能夠利用 Vue Echarts 構建一個股票應用了。這個應用的功能之一就是實時更新股票數據,以便用戶作出及時的決策。
上一篇vue echarts
下一篇c 后臺如何處理json